Death toll in Nepal mudslide approaches 800 as rescue efforts intensify

Authorities in Nepal reported that the death toll from a catastrophic mudslide caused by a glacier collapse has risen to 781, with an additional 2,502 people still missing. Chinese officials added 16 more deaths and 546 missing, bringing the total number of fatalities close to 800.

Cross‑border disaster and international response

Chinese Foreign Minister Wang Yi told his Nepalese counterpart that the event was the “most severe cross‑border disaster” in recent years. Rescue operations have become increasingly difficult due to rugged Himalayan terrain, worsening weather, and rising water levels.

Dozens of Americans are among the nearly 600 foreign nationals reported missing by Nepal’s tourism board. The board said two Americans have been rescued and a third is being contacted. Chinese authorities reported 261 foreign nationals from 23 countries unaccounted for in Tibet near a key border crossing.

Mass burials and health concerns

With bodies beginning to decompose, Nepalese officials have started mass burials of unidentified victims. Nearly 100 bodies were buried on August 29, and another 100 are planned for August 30. DNA samples have been collected and burial sites documented to aid families in identifying loved ones.

“We were left with no other option,” said Ganesh Aryal, chief district officer of Chitwan, explaining the public‑health risk posed by rapid decomposition.

Ongoing rescue challenges

Rescuers continue to face hazardous conditions, including bad weather that has forced temporary suspensions of operations since August 28. A newly formed lake at the Nepal‑China border threatens further flooding as it overflows into the Lhende Khola and Trishuli Rivers.

Local police reported residents and rescue workers moving to higher ground after river levels rose on August 30 following fresh rainfall.

Impact and climate link

Chinese state media linked the disaster to long‑term effects of global warming, describing the flood as a “new and prominent feature of cryosphere disasters” on the Tibetan plateau.

The Red Cross estimates that more than 90,000 people have been affected by the mudslide, which struck around 8:30 a.m. local time on August 26. The landslide destroyed homes, infrastructure, and swept away entire communities.
